LOPERA MESA, Gloria Patricia. "The top of the hill is for small miners". On the validity of the special regime for Marmato mining and its influence on the construction of territoriality. Rev. Derecho Estado [online]. 2015, n.35, pp.101-150. ISSN 0122-9893.  https://doi.org/10.18601/01229893.n35.05.

This article examines the circumstances that led to the issuance of a special regime for Marmato mines in the mid-twentieth century, which reserves the top of the hill for the small-scale Mining exploitation. It also explores the validity of these rules and how they have influenced the social construction of territoriality and a way of life developed around the traditional practice of small mining.

Palavras-chave : Mining legislation; Marmato; small-scale mining; territoriality; social and environmental conflict.
